Catalysis of Hydrogen Evolution on Au(111) Modified by Spontaneously Deposited Pd Nanoislands 

Smiljanić, Milutin Lj.; Srejić, Irina; Grgur, Branimir; Rakočević, Zlatko Lj.; Štrbac, Svetlana (Electrocatalysis, 2012)
Hydrogen evolution reaction was studied on Au(111) modified by palladium spontaneously deposited on the Au(111) surface from (1 mM PdSO4 center dot 2 H2O + 0.5 M H2SO4) solution at a submonolayer coverage. Number and size ...

Ethanol Oxidation on Pd/Au(111) Bimetallic Surfaces in Alkaline Solution 

Smiljanić, Milutin Lj.; Rakočević, Zlatko Lj.; Štrbac, Svetlana (International Journal of Electrochemical Science, 2013)
Catalytic properties of Pd/Au(111) nanostructures obtained by spontaneous palladium deposition using PdSO4 and PdCl2 salts were examined for the oxidation of ethanol in alkaline media. Atomic force microscopy has shown ...
